Job description

We have an exciting opportunity for a Technology Delivery Manager to join our Technology and Operations directorate.

This is a key role supporting the successful delivery of technology projects across ICAS. Working closely with senior leaders, business stakeholders, internal teams and external suppliers, you will help translate business needs into clear requirements, delivery plans and practical technology solutions that create value for our customers, colleagues and stakeholders.

The role brings together product ownership, project delivery and business analysis. You will oversee a portfolio of technology-related projects, ensuring priorities, dependencies, risks and progress are visible and actively managed. You will also champion agile ways of working, helping teams adopt consistent delivery practices while taking a pragmatic approach to different project needs.

You will play an important role in supporting successful implementation, business readiness and benefits realisation, ensuring technology change is delivered in a structured, collaborative and outcome-focused way.

Requirements

We are looking for someone who can bring structure, pace and clarity to technology delivery, while building strong relationships across technical and non-technical teams. You will have a proven track record in programme, product or technology delivery management, with experience of taking business priorities from early discovery and scoping through to delivery, implementation and measurable outcomes. You will be comfortable working across multiple workstreams, shaping delivery plans, managing dependencies and ensuring stakeholders have the right information at the right time to make informed decisions.

Ideally, you will bring:

· Experience in a product management, project management, business analysis or technology delivery role.

· A strong understanding of agile delivery methods, including Scrum, Kanban or hybrid agile approaches.

· The ability to manage technology projects across the full delivery lifecycle, from discovery and requirements through to implementation and closure.

· Confidence translating complex business requirements into clear delivery artefacts for technical teams and suppliers, including user stories, acceptance criteria and delivery plans.

· Strong stakeholder management, facilitation, negotiation and communication skills.

· Experience managing risks, issues, dependencies, priorities and competing demands across multiple projects.

· The ability to coordinate internal resources, external suppliers and subject matter experts to support effective delivery.

· A collaborative, proactive and delivery-focused approach, with sound judgement and problem-solving skills.

You will also bring the confidence to act as a bridge between business areas, internal technology teams and external suppliers, translating requirements into clear, practical delivery activity and keeping momentum when priorities or requirements change. Experience of delivery tools such as Jira, Azure DevOps, Trello, Microsoft Planner, Confluence or SharePoint would be helpful. Relevant qualifications in agile delivery, project management, product ownership or business analysis would also be advantageous.

Just as importantly, you will be comfortable working confidently in a busy, changing environment. You will be organised, resilient and able to balance detail with the bigger picture, with the ability to prioritise effectively and keep delivery moving at pace. You will be curious, solutions-focused and confident asking the right questions to understand business needs, challenge constructively and identify practical ways forward. A collaborative working style, strong judgement and the ability to build trust with colleagues, senior stakeholders and suppliers will be key to success in this role.
